Original title: Turn in the “Jade Bird Project” to spread its wings and soar “Generation Z” new season release

News from China Central Broadcasting Network, September 27 (Reporter Zhou Hong) A few days ago, the “Third Space”, the golden mine that stood out in the first batch of “Blue Bird Project”, was formed by him as the representative and convener of the blue bird artist. The “New Classical Chamber Orchestra”, together with the young pianist Wang Yalun, used a concert that highlights the artistic style and musical ideals of young people to announce to the world. After a year of training, the “Blue Bird Project” has been fully upgraded to spread its wings again.

Last year, the “Jade Bird Project” was advocated by Yu Long, the famous conductor and music director of the Shanghai Symphony Orchestra, and soared. In the past year since its implementation, this “Young Artist Incubation Program” has been very effective. It has unearthed and launched a group of young music talents with artistic ideals, solid musical skills and steady execution capabilities.

“For young musicians, it takes not only a long time to grow up, but also an open space and a starting point for a broad stage, allowing them to cross the traditional barriers and continue to output their passion and imagination for art. Continue to explore and broaden the boundaries of music.” Talking about the original intention of launching the “Blue Bird Project”, Long Yu said: “We insist on giving young people a high degree of freedom and as much support as possible, so that talented performers can be more comfortable. Participate in it, instead of having to worry about some commercial and practical factors at the beginning of the pursuit of art, which will affect their understanding and creation. In the Jade Bird Project, all they need to do is to firmly realize themselves and their works. Incubation and growth.”

Comprehensively upgrade the “Jade Bird Project” and spread its wings again

The “Jade Bird Project” relies on conductor Yu Long and the Shanghai Symphony Orchestra, focuses on young music practitioners and students with musical ideals and management skills, and strives to provide young people with galloping imagination, including art management operations and music performances And creativity music platform. As an “incubation platform” for young talents, the “Blue Bird Project” is not only for a few elite groups, but for every young man with a musical dream; there is no organizer’s prescribed actions in the “Blue Bird Project”, and young people can go. Make every step of your own planning and grow into an independent and mature individual artist.

In fact, the “Blue Bird Project 2.0” has already demonstrated the absolute right to speak of the “Blue Birds” as the protagonists. They direct and perform themselves, and even formulate the rules of the game themselves, and build a complete structure with rules and systems. The first level in the structure can be described as “zero threshold”, you can register to become a member of the “Blue Bird Project”; then, you can earn points by participating in performances and be promoted to a member of the second level “Z-Club” (Generation Z). And then have its own exclusive music season. More importantly, all links are checked by young people, which completely changes the tradition that institutions usually formulate and implement development plans and protect young people’s artistic ambitions of “initiating a’revolution’ that will change the classical music industry.” The famous conductor Yu Long and the Shanghai Symphony Orchestra retreated behind the scenes in the “Jade Bird Project 2.0” to provide guarantee and support, and give them all to these young people who have grown up from the 1.0 project to take the lead.

Not only that, the “Blue Bird Project” also solves the industry’s pain points that young musicians can only be paid attention and get opportunities by participating in competitions. It links with the Shanghai Symphony Orchestra, other domestic professional orchestras, and art brokerage companies to provide their music ambitions. He Art Passion provides space for exhibition, from “thinking” to “doing”, helping young people to start their music career quickly and drive onto the overtaking lane. The “Jade Bird Project” will become an important part of the Xuhui-Hengfu style district to create a music district. It will gather the immeasurable power of young Chinese music. Its vision is not a performance or a music event, but a long-term continuous promotion of young artists. The lofty pattern allows the world to see the promising future of Chinese music.

Through the Jade Bird Project 1.0, a group of vigorous young musicians have gained experience, gradually enriched their wings, and started their careers in the “Third Space”. For example, Jinyu Mine, which was born in 2000, not only won the second place in the two international conductor competitions of Khachaturian and Only Stage this year, but also joined the “Neo-Classical Chamber Orchestra” on stage at the Shanghai Summer Music Festival. The repertoire setting won an applause; another “Blue Bird”, Lin Ruifeng, who is also a member of the “New Classical Chamber Orchestra”, also appeared in the finals of the just-concluded “2020 Shanghai Isaac Stern International Violin Competition”. During the plan upgrade process, it is even more dominant throughout the whole process, which vividly reflects the diverse musical tastes and efficient execution of young people. Countless brainstorms have resulted in a plethora of nearly ten document proposals, including start-up documents, project white papers, operating cost calculations, management talent absorption methods, publicity and operation rules, etc., which not only describe in detail what the “post-00s” think The blueprint for music and the specific implementation methods for the realization of the blueprint. Young people even discuss in the proposal how to split the box office, how to achieve revenue and other important issues related to the operation of the organization.
